Fort Mountain State Park Chatsworth, GA

Named after an ancient and mysterious 855 foot-long rock wall which stands on the highest point of the mountain which is thought to have been built by Indians as fortification against other more hostile Indians or for ancient ceremonies, this 3,712 acre park is situated in the Chattahoochee National Forest close to the Cohutta Wilderness area and features 70 tent and RV sites, 15 cottages, a 17 acre lake with a swimming beach, picnic shelters, 14 miles of hiking trails, 30 miles of mountain biking trails, a miniature golf course, fishing and pedal boat rentals, and 18 miles of horseback riding trails.
